How much do dod finance j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for dod finance in the United States is $124,326.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$94,500.00 and $168,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a dod finance?

A DoD Finance job involves managing financial operations for the U.S. Department of Defense, including budgeting, accounting, and financial analysis. Professionals in this field ensure compliance with federal regulations, oversee expenditures, and support financial planning for military and defense-related programs. They may work in various roles, such as financial analysts, accountants, or budget officers. These positions typically require knowledge of government financial systems, regulations, and security clearances depending on the role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the dod finance position?

To thrive in a DoD Finance role, you need expertise in governmental accounting, budget analysis, and compliance, often backed by a degree in finance, accounting, or a related field. Familiarity with financial management systems such as GFEBS, DFAS tools, and certifications like DoD FM Certification are commonly required. Str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ication are essential soft skills for success in this environment. These competencies are critical because DoD Finance professionals must ensure accuracy, transparency, and regulatory compliance in managing federal funds and financial reporting within a complex organizational structure.

What are some typical challenges faced by professionals working in dod finance positions?

Professionals in DoD Finance often navigate complex budgeting processes, strict regulatory requirements, and rapidly evolving policies. They may encounter challenges related to balancing multiple projects, ensuring timely and compliant reporting, and adapting to frequent updates in federal financial management systems. Additionally, collaborating across various military departments and with civilian personnel can require strong interpersonal and negotiation skills. However, these challenges also offer opportunities to develop specialized expertise and contribute to the success and integrity of critical defense operations.

PeopleTec is currently seeking a Business and Financial Analyst to support our Huntsville, AL location.

We are seeking a Business and Financial Analyst to support the Army's Portfolio Acquisition Executive Fires Office (PAE Fires). This role involves leading budget formulation, execution, and reporting activities to ensure the effective allocation and utilization of resources in support of mission objectives. The Budget Analyst will collaborate with program managers, contracting officers, and other stakeholders to ensure compliance with Department of Defense (DoD) financial regulations and policies. This is a fast-paced role requiring strong analytical, organizational, and communication skills.

Duties:

  • Develop, prepare, and manage program budgets, including Program Objective Memorandum (POM) submissions, spend plans, and obligation/expenditure forecasts.
  • Coordinate and execute funding actions, including drafting and submitting Purchase Requisitions (PRs), Military Interdepartmental Purchase Requests (MIPRs), and Direct Charge (DC) transactions.
  • Monitor and track the execution of funds to ensure alignment with program goals and timelines.
  • Conduct detailed financial analyses to identify trends, variances, and risks.
  • Prepare and present financial reports, briefings, and recommendations to leadership and stakeholders.
  • Maintain historical financial records and update funding history tracking when funds are received.
  • Monitor contract status, including ceiling limits, periods of performance, and funding requirements.
  • Support Contracting Officer Representatives (CORs) by analyzing monthly contractor reports, facilitating communication, and supporting  documentation for contract actions (e.g. Technical Directives (TDs) and Requests for Services Contract Approval (RSCAs).
  • Participate in Contract Integrated Product Teams (IPTs), Program Management Reviews (PMRs), and financial/metrics meetings.
  • Ensure compliance with DoD financial management regulations, policies, and procedures.
  • Facilitate fiscal year-end close to ensure 100% obligation of expiring funds.
  • Support audits and reviews by providing accurate and timely financial data.
  • Coordinate with program managers and technical leads to align financial plans with program objectives.
  • Facilitate financial communication and coordination between the Project Office, higher headquarters, and external customers.
Qualifications

Required Skills/Experience:

  • Minimum of 5 years of relevant experience in budget analysis, financial management, or related roles, preferably within the DoD or federal government.
  • Demonstrated experience with DoD financial systems, including General Fund Enterprise Business System (GFEBS).
  • Experience preparing and submitting PRs, MIPRs, and DC transactions.
  • Proven ability to monitor funds execution and create financial reports.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ite, including advanced Excel functions (e.g., pivot tables, VLOOKUP, and data visualization).
  • Familiarity with financial management tools and software used in DoD environments.
  • Strong understanding of DoD financial regulations, including the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) and DoD Financial Management Regulation (FMR).
  • Knowledge of appropriations, funding types, and fiscal law principles.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to present complex financial data to diverse audiences.
  • Ability to manage diverse workloads of complex and priority projects without supervision.
  • Strong leadership, analytical, and organizational skills.
  • Must have a current driver's license.
  • Travel: 20%
  • Must be a U.S. Citizen
  • Active U.S. DoD Secret clearance is required to perform this work.

Education Requirements:

  • Bachelor's degree in Finance, Accounting, Business Administration, or a related field.
  • Master's degree preferred.

Desired Skills:

  • 10+ years of relevant experience in financial management, budget analysis, or related roles within the DoD.
  • Certification in financial management or related areas (e.g., Certified Defense Financial Manager (CDFM), DoD Financial Management Certification).
  • Familiarity with rapid acquisition or prototyping programs and their unique financial requirements.
  • In-depth understanding of the Planning, Programming, Budgeting, and Execution (PPBE) process.
  • Ability to provide guidance and informal mentoring to junior analysts, as required.
  • Ability to identify and implement innovative solutions to improve financial processes and program outcomes.
  • Experience using data visualization and advanced analytics tools.
